The University of Tulsa started in 1882 as Henry Kendall College and has grown into a leading private research institution that embraces a foundation for liberal arts while preparing students for a prosperous lifetime. It is a private, autonomous institution awarding a doctoral degree whose mission reflects these core values, scholarship excellence, commitment to free inquiry, honesty of character, and dedication to humanity.

Today, TulsaUniversity exists as an autonomous university that is non-denominational. Students from many different religions and countries are accepted. Tulsa provides academically rigorous services that change learners and the community. With open arms, the foreign students are greeted. Via co-curricular and extracurricular activities and student development programs, it offers programs and services designed to encourage academic achievement and global leadership that expand their educational experiences. The university fosters an atmosphere that makes it possible for professors to be personally involved in the growth of and student.
